Chasing oven spring with a cheap Dutch oven
For a month my loaves spread sideways instead of up. The dough was fine; the steam was not. So I baked the same dough three ways on three Saturdays.
| Setup | Preheat | Height | Crust |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baking sheet, pan of water | 30 min | 7.5 cm | Pale, thick |
| Dutch oven, lid on 20 min | 30 min | 9.0 cm | Good, dull |
| Dutch oven, preheated 60 min | 60 min | 10.5 cm | Blistered, glossy |
What made the difference
- A full hour of preheating. The cast iron needs it far more than the oven does.
- Scoring at a shallow angle, about 30°, with one confident stroke.
- Lowering the dough in on parchment instead of dropping it and hoping.
The pot was the cheapest enamelled one I could find. It works perfectly; the knob on the lid is the only thing that did not survive 250 °C.
